Cleaning stored diesel in place: filtering out water, sludge, and microbial growth so old fuel runs like new. Here is when standby fuel needs it.
When diesel sits long enough, water and microbial growth turn it into a problem: sludge that clogs filters, acids that corrode, and a fuel supply that can stall the engine it was meant to protect. Fuel polishing fixes that in place.
The process circulates the stored fuel through filtration that pulls out water, removes the microbial growth and particulates, and returns clean diesel to the tank. You keep your fuel. You get it back in reliable shape.
Polishing is insurance, not repair. The point is to find and fix degraded fuel before the generator gets called, not after it fails to start. For critical standby power, clean fuel is part of the system, the same as a load test.
